Abstract
Zinc oxide nanoparticles within faujasite zeolites have been synthesized by a procedure comprising of (i) ion-exchange of zinc ions into the zeolite, (ii) precipitation of zinc ions with sodium hydroxide within the supercage of the zeolite, and (iii) calcination. The products were characterized by XRD, SEM, TEM, EDX and FTIR techniques. The size of the ZnO particles was in the range of 24±4 nm. Finally, ZnO@zeolite was used as a pigment and its optical properties were studied.
